From 6477987608da99ae3762bcd9fd9bf2e0509dfc29 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ayobami Adegoke Date: Wed, 8 Jul 2026 16:09:33 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] ci: add GitHub Actions workflow - LaTeX smoke compiles, skill lint, CLI typechecks, placeholder integrity (#59) Every PR to this repo is currently verified by hand. This adds the checks a machine can do: - latex-smoke: compiles cv/main_example.tex (lualatex) and the new cover_letters/cover_example.tex (xelatex) in the texlive/texlive container, failing on any LaTeX error. Exact page-count assertions (CV=2, cover letter=1) run on the upstream repo only - lint (tools/lint_skills.py, also runnable locally): every SKILL.md has parseable YAML frontmatter with name+description (frontmatter breakage happened before - 37a0eed), allowed-tools 'bun run ' targets exist, command files start with a '# /' title, settings.json is valid JSON with a permissions.allow list - cli-typecheck: bun install + tsc --noEmit for all five portal CLIs (matrix, fail-fast off) - placeholder-integrity (upstream only): tracked template files still carry their placeholder tokens, catching accidental personal-data commits before they land Fork-friendly by design: /setup personalizes CLAUDE.md, the skill files, and main_example.tex in forks, so placeholder checks and exact page counts are guarded with github.repository == upstream; compile success and lint run everywhere. Live CLI smoke tests are deliberately excluded: network-flaky, and linkedin-search is personal-use-only per its own ToS warning - CI-automated requests would violate it. CLIs are typechecked instead. The cover letter previously had no tracked example (cover_*.tex is gitignored), so cover_example.tex is new: a placeholder letter following the documented 06 structure, demonstrating the correct itemize-outside- lettercontent pattern. It doubles as the structural reference /apply Step 2 looks for on fresh clones, which until now matched nothing. The gitignore exception is ordered after Cover_*.tex because case-insensitive filesystems match that pattern against cover_example.tex too. Writing it surfaced a latent bug in the documented template itself: 06-cover-letter-templates.md's structure ends with \closing{Kind regards,\} - but cover.cls appends its own \, and the doubled break produces '! LaTeX Error: There's no line here to end.' on every compile (nonstopmode swallows it, so it went unnoticed).
